Job summary

Jobgether in Canada seeks an Environmental, Health & Safety (EHS) Manager – International Operations to lead global EHS framework development, governance and continuous improvement across aviation operations.

You will collaborate with regional teams, ensure regulatory alignment, monitor risk, and report to leadership, while fostering a strong safety culture and driving measurable improvements.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ree in Occupational Health & Safety, Environmental Science, Engineering, or a related discipline.
  • Professional certification preferred, such as NEBOSH, IOSH, CRSP, CSP, or equivalent qualifications.
  • Minimum 10 years of progressive EHS experience within aviation, industrial, manufacturing, or operational environments.
  • Demonstrated experience managing EHS programs across international locations or multi-site organizations.
  • Proven ability to design, implement, and standardize global policies, procedures, and safety frameworks.

Responsibilities

  • Develop, maintain, and govern a standardized global EHS management framework aligned with aviation risks, regulatory requirements, and organizational safety objectives.
  • Provide guidance and standardization support to regional EHS teams, ensuring consistent implementation of policies, procedures, tools, and reporting practices.
  • Monitor EHS performance, compliance trends, and risk indicators across international operations, escalating significant issues and non-conformities when required.
  • Create and improve global EHS policies, procedures, minimum standards, and internal controls while balancing global consistency with local regulatory requirements.
  • Ensure alignment of EHS practices across aviation maintenance, ground operations, facilities, hazardous materials management, ergonomics, and contractor safety activities.
  • Identify and assess workplace health, safety, and environmental risks and support the implementation of effective mitigation strategies.
  • Coordinate EHS incident reporting, investigations, root cause analysis, and corrective/preventive action processes while monitoring progress toward resolution.
  • Maintain compliance registers and oversee alignment with applicable international, national, and local EHS regulations and industry best practices.
  • Support audit and assurance activities by preparing documentation, coordinating site readiness, and ensuring timely closure of corrective actions.
  • Deliver consolidated EHS reporting, trend analysis, and risk insights to leadership teams and governance committees.
  • Promote a strong safety culture through coaching, awareness initiatives, training programs, and collaboration with operational stakeholders.
  • Partner with safety, quality, risk, maintenance, and operational teams to strengthen governance and continuous improvement.
